This ‘adversarial’ pattern can prevent surveillance cameras from detecting you
AI Summary

Researcher Bill Swearingen has developed computer-generated patterns that can be applied to clothing or vehicles to scramble surveillance camera detection algorithms. The project, called noRecognition, aims to provide individuals with a way to opt-out of automated tracking and facial recognition systems.

Bill Swearingen has spent the past year running largely the same test, over and over again. The goal was to produce a computer-generated pattern that could block the surveillance cameras lining America’s streets from detecting it.
